You will never spot them with the naked eye, yet dust mites may be the reason you wake up congested, rub itchy eyes at the kitchen table, or feel your asthma tighten the moment you lie down. These microscopic arachnids do not bite, sting, or spread disease — but proteins in their feces, urine, and decaying bodies can trigger allergic rhinitis and asthma in sensitive people. The American Lung Association notes that roughly four out of five U.S. homes have dust mite allergens in at least one bed. You cannot evict every mite, but you can cut their numbers sharply and, more importantly, remove the allergens that make you miserable. The plan below ranks what works by impact, not by how many products you can buy.

What Dust Mites Actually Are (and What They Are Not)

Dust mites (Dermatophagoides species) are eight-legged relatives of spiders, roughly 0.2–0.3 millimeters long — far too small to see without magnification. They feed on dead human skin cells that collect in bedding, upholstered furniture, carpets, and dust. They are not parasites: they do not burrow into skin or draw blood the way bed bugs or fleas do. If you have visible bites or blood spots on sheets, look elsewhere. Dust mite reactions come from inhaling or contacting settled allergen particles, not from being bitten.

Why You Cannot See Them but Still React

Because mites stay embedded in fabrics rather than flying around the room, many people assume the problem is “just dust.” In reality, most exposure happens in bed. The Lung Association explains that dust mite allergens settle quickly into mattresses, pillows, and blankets rather than staying airborne for long periods. That is why symptoms often peak overnight and on waking, then improve when you leave the house. A bedroom that looks clean can still harbor millions of mites in the mattress alone.

How Dust Mites Trigger Allergies and Asthma

For people with dust mite sensitivity, the immune system treats mite proteins as threats. Inflammation in the nasal passages — what clinicians call allergic rhinitis — can produce sneezing, runny nose, itchy eyes, and facial pressure. In asthma, the same exposure can cause coughing, chest tightness, wheezing, and attacks. Dust mites are among the major indoor asthma triggers cited by the Lung Association, and ongoing bedroom exposure keeps airways primed for flares even when outdoor pollen is low.

Symptoms That Point to Dust — Not Bed Bugs or Mold

Dust mite clues include year-round symptoms that worsen in humid months, improvement on vacation (especially in dry climates), and a pattern tied to lying on fabric surfaces. Bed bug infestations usually add itchy welts in lines, visible bugs or stains, and odor in severe cases. Mold allergy often tracks musty smell, visible growth, or water damage. If symptoms persist after a thorough bedding and humidity overhaul, ask an allergist about skin-prick or blood testing rather than buying more cleaning products.

Where Dust Mites Hide in Your Home

Mites need warmth, food (skin flakes), and humidity. They absorb water from the air rather than drinking it, which is why humid homes support far larger populations than dry ones. Priority zones include mattresses and box springs, pillows, duvets, sheets, upholstered sofas and chairs, wall-to-wall carpet, area rugs, curtains, and stuffed toys. MedlinePlus adds that house dust itself can carry pollen, mold spores, and fabric fibers — so “dust allergy” is often a bundle of triggers, with mites as the dominant one in bedrooms.

Closets with hanging clothes, furnace return grilles, and pet beds can also accumulate allergen-laden dust. Basements with moisture above 50% relative humidity can sustain mites in carpet or stored textiles even when upstairs feels fine. Map your home by time spent breathing near fabric — that is where control efforts pay off first.

Your Dust Mite Control Plan: What to Do First

Trying to scrub every room on day one leads to burnout. A staged plan works better:

Week 1 — Bedroom lockdown: hot-wash all bedding, install encasements, set humidity targets, HEPA-vacuum the floor and mattress surface.

Week 2 — Whole-home moisture and floors: address basement dampness, swap dry-dusting for damp methods, steam or vacuum upholstered furniture.

Ongoing — Weekly bedding wash, monthly filter checks, seasonal carpet steam. Allergen levels drop gradually; give the routine three to four weeks before judging results.

Priority 1: Bedroom and Bedding

You spend roughly one-third of your life in bed — and the Lung Association states that most dust mite allergen exposure occurs while sleeping. Start here even if living-room carpet looks worse. Strip the bed, wash everything washable, encase mattress and pillows, and keep stuffed animals off the bed or launder them weekly.

Priority 2: Humidity and Temperature

Humidity is the single biggest environmental lever. The Lung Association advises keeping indoor humidity below 50%. Mites thrive around 68–77°F (20–25°C) with moisture available; cooler, drier air slows reproduction. This does not mean living in a cold house — it means measuring RH and using AC, exhaust fans, or dehumidifiers where needed.

Priority 3: Floors, Upholstery, and Clutter

After the bedroom, tackle carpet, rugs, and fabric furniture that hold skin flakes. Hard flooring with washable rugs is easier to maintain than wall-to-wall pile. Reduce knickknacks and fabric-heavy decor that collect dust you cannot easily wash.

Wash Bedding the Right Way

White sheets and pillowcases in a front-loading washing machine for hot-water laundry

Heat kills dust mites quickly — but washing also flushes allergens down the drain, which freezing alone does not accomplish. MedlinePlus recommends washing bedding and pillows once a week in hot water between 130°F and 140°F (54–60°C). The Lung Association cites at least 120°F (49°C). If your water heater is set lower for scalding safety, use the sanitize or extra-hot cycle on the washer, or run items through a dryer on high heat for at least 15 minutes after a warm wash.

Wash sheets, pillowcases, mattress pads, and duvet covers weekly. Down comforters that cannot fit in home machines may need commercial laundry or seasonal replacement with washable alternatives. For items that cannot be washed, a 24-hour freezer cycle in a sealed bag kills live mites, but allergen proteins remain until you vacuum or wash the fabric — treat freezing as a supplement, not a complete fix.

Pillows themselves should be washed or replaced on schedule. Synthetic washable pillows outperform non-washable feather types for allergy households unless you commit to professional cleaning. Pull covers back each morning to air the bed briefly; this lowers surface moisture that mites prefer.

Mattress and Pillow Encasements That Work

Zippered white allergen-proof mattress encasement on a bed

Encasements are the highest-return purchase for many allergy sufferers. Look for zippered, allergen-proof covers labeled for dust mites — woven tightly enough to block mite passage and allergen escape. Install them on mattress, box spring, and every pillow you sleep on. Existing mites trapped inside die over weeks as food supply is cut off, but dead mites still release allergen, which is why encasements pair with regular hot washing of outer bedding.

Wash encasement surfaces on the same weekly schedule as sheets, following manufacturer instructions. Cheap vinyl covers that tear or unzip at the corner defeat the purpose. If your mattress is old and heavily colonized, encasements plus aggressive washing may still leave high allergen load — replacing the mattress after encasing a new one is sometimes the pragmatic choice for severe allergy.

Choose smooth, tightly woven duvet covers over ruffled or tufted styles that trap lint. Limit decorative throw pillows on the bed; each one is another mite reservoir.

Vacuuming, Steam Cleaning, and HEPA Filters

Canister vacuum cleaner on low-pile carpet in a tidy living room

Vacuuming removes mites, feces, and skin flakes from carpet and upholstery — but a standard vacuum can blow fine particles back into the room. MedlinePlus and the Lung Association both recommend vacuums with HEPA (high-efficiency particulate air) filtration or double-layer microfilter bags. Vacuum carpet and fabric furniture weekly at minimum; high-traffic allergy homes may need more.

Steam cleaning kills mites when surface temperatures reach roughly 200°F (93°C) or higher — typical of commercial carpet steamers on a slow pass. Test upholstery in a hidden spot first; excess heat damages some fabrics. Steam complements but does not replace hot laundering of bedding.

When you dust hard furniture, use a damp microfiber cloth rather than a dry feather duster that launches allergens airborne. Work top to bottom, rinse or launder cloths after use, and wear a mask if you are the allergic person doing the cleaning — or leave the house during someone else’s deep clean.

Reduce Indoor Humidity Below 50 Percent

Because mites drink from humid air, dropping relative humidity is one of the few strategies that attacks population growth house-wide. The Lung Association’s threshold is below 50% RH; MedlinePlus suggests 30–50% for broader mold and allergen control. Buy a hygrometer for the bedroom and basement — guessing fails.

Run bathroom exhaust fans during and after showers, fix leaky windows and crawl-space moisture, and empty dehumidifier tanks daily (clean with vinegar regularly to prevent mold in the unit). In humid climates, air conditioning is often the most effective dehumidifier you already own. Avoid over-humidifying with vaporizers in bedrooms; mite counts rise when RH climbs above 55–60%.

Cooler bedroom temperatures (around 65–68°F) slow mite reproduction modestly, but moisture control matters more than turning the thermostat down alone.

Hard Floors, Curtains, and Clutter Control

Wall-to-wall carpet is the hardest surface to keep mite-poor: fibers bind skin cells and hold moisture. The Lung Association recommends hard flooring — wood, tile, laminate, or vinyl — especially when occupants are allergic, with washable area rugs for comfort. If carpet must stay, commit to HEPA vacuuming plus periodic steam and keep pets off bedroom carpet when possible.

Replace heavy drapes with machine-washable curtains or wipeable blinds. Launder curtains seasonally at minimum. Store off-season clothing in closed bins rather than open closet shelves that collect dust.

Clutter is mite habitat in disguise. Books, fabric baskets, and open shelving display dust collectors. Glass-front cabinets, closed storage, and rotating displays make damp-dusting realistic. In kids’ rooms, limit plush toys on the bed; weekly hot washes or freezer cycles for favorites, and store extras outside the bedroom.

HVAC Filters and Portable Air Purifiers

Central HVAC systems circulate dust through every room. Use high-quality pleated filters rated for your system (MERV per manufacturer limits — overly dense filters can restrict airflow). Change filters on schedule, often every one to three months in allergy homes. Clean return grilles and consider professional duct cleaning only if you see visible contamination — routine duct cleaning alone has not proven to lower mite allergens significantly.

Portable HEPA air purifiers help capture airborne particles stirred up during cleaning, but they are secondary to source control in bedding and carpet. Size the unit to room volume, run it on the bedroom during sleep if symptoms are worst at night, and replace prefilters and HEPA cartridges per label. Do not forget window AC filters, dryer lint paths, and range hood grease screens — they are not mite-specific but reduce overall dust load.

Natural Options: Essential Oils and the Evidence

Laboratory work has shown that clove oil and, in some studies, eucalyptus and rosemary compounds can kill or repel mites in controlled conditions — but concentration, contact time, and surface type determine real-world effect. A 2014 study in the Asian Pacific Journal of Allergy and Immunology found clove oil (Eugenia caryophyllus) acaricidal at tested concentrations; home use with a few drops in water may not replicate lab kill rates.

If you try oils, patch-test fabrics for staining, avoid heavy saturation on mattresses you breathe against for hours, and never assume scent equals safety. VCA Animal Hospitals warns that many essential oils are toxic to dogs and cats (tea tree, pennyroyal, citrus, pine, and others). Diffusing oils with pets in closed bedrooms is risky. For most households, hot wash plus encasements outperform oil sprays with fewer side effects.

Commercial Dust Mite Sprays: When They Help (and When They Do Not)

Store shelves offer acaricide sprays, tannic acid treatments, and “natural” fabric mists. Some pesticide-based products kill on contact but may leave residues you do not want on pillows. Tannic acid denatures allergens on carpet but can discolor fabric and requires repeat application. Read labels for EPA registration, child and pet re-entry intervals, and whether the product kills mites, neutralizes allergen, or only masks odor.

Test in an inconspicuous area, vacuum after drying as directed, and weigh cost against encasements and laundry, which address the primary reservoir. Sprays make sense as short-term bridge after moving into a carpeted rental or when you cannot replace a sofa immediately — not as a substitute for weekly hot washing.

Mistakes That Waste Time or Worsen Symptoms

Cold or lukewarm washes leave mites alive in sheets. Dry dusting resuspends allergen. Unzipped or torn encasements leak allergens for years. Freezing stuffed toys without washing kills mites but leaves protein behind. Relying on air purifiers alone while sleeping on an unprotected decade-old mattress rarely works.

UV wands and gimmick “mite vacuums” without HEPA capture lack strong evidence for home use. Lowering humidity with unvented gas heaters or chronic overcooling creates other health risks. Essential oil overload can irritate airways — the opposite of your goal. Finally, confusing bed bugs with mites delays the right treatment; bites and visible insects mean a pest inspection, not more hot water.

If you implement the bedroom and humidity plan faithfully for a month and asthma or rhinitis remains disabling, see an allergist about immunotherapy, medication, and environmental testing rather than escalating harsh chemicals.

Conclusion

Getting rid of dust mites in the absolute sense is not realistic — they are nearly universal in humid homes — but getting rid of the problem they cause is. Anchor your routine on weekly hot-water bedding washes, zippered mattress and pillow encasements, humidity below 50%, and HEPA vacuuming of carpets and upholstery. Add steam, hard flooring, and careful clutter reduction where your home layout allows. Treat heat as your fastest kill tool, laundering as your best allergen removal tool, and moisture control as your long-term population brake.

Start in the bedroom this week, measure humidity before buying gadgets, and judge results over a few wash cycles — not a single deep clean. Your goal is fewer mites, far less allergen where you breathe eight hours a night, and symptoms that finally match the effort you put in.

Frequently asked questions

What kills dust mites immediately?

Heat is the fastest reliable kill method at home. Wash fabrics at 130°F (54°C) or higher, tumble dry on high heat for at least 15 minutes, or steam-clean carpet and upholstery at temperatures around 200°F (93°C) or above. Freezing non-washable items for 24 hours kills live mites but does not remove allergen proteins — follow with vacuuming or washing when possible.

How do you know if you have dust mites?

You cannot see dust mites without a microscope, so diagnosis is based on pattern and testing. Clues include year-round allergy symptoms that worsen in bed or humid weather, sneezing and congestion on waking, and improvement in dry climates or after encasing bedding. An allergist can confirm sensitivity with skin or blood tests; visible bites or bugs suggest other pests, not mites.

Does vacuuming get rid of dust mites?

Vacuuming removes mites, waste, and skin flakes from carpet and upholstery but does not eliminate them from mattresses or bedding. Use a vacuum with true HEPA filtration, go slowly over high-traffic areas weekly, and pair vacuuming with hot washing of linens. Vacuuming without encasements or humidity control treats symptoms, not the main reservoir in your bed.

What humidity level keeps dust mites under control?

Keep indoor relative humidity below 50%, with many experts targeting 30–50% for broader allergen and mold control. Dust mites absorb moisture from the air and struggle in dry conditions. Use a hygrometer, run bathroom exhaust fans, fix leaks, and use AC or a dehumidifier in humid months rather than guessing from comfort alone.

Are essential oils a safe way to repel dust mites around pets?

Essential oils are not a first-line fix and can be unsafe for pets. Lab studies show some oils, such as clove, may kill mites at specific concentrations, but home sprays rarely match those conditions. VCA Animal Hospitals notes many oils are toxic to dogs and cats. Prioritize hot-water laundry, encasements, and humidity control; if you use oils, keep pets out of treated rooms, avoid heavy application on bedding, and consult your veterinarian first.
